Post-Pandemic Economic Transitions Drive Sustainable Urban Innovation

Economic collapses, like the one triggered by COVID-19, can act as catalysts for significant shifts towards sustainable urban development, driven by climate agendas and emerging technologies.

Urban Science · 2020

01

Key Findings

  • 01Economic collapses can trigger innovation waves, often tied to new energy and infrastructure priorities.
  • 02Future economic transitions are likely to be driven by sustainability goals (zero carbon, zero poverty), supported by technologies like renewable energy, electromobility, and circular economy solutions.
  • 03Urban transformations may lead to 'global localism', with distributed infrastructure, tailored local innovations, reduced car dependence, new funding partnerships, and evolving professional practices.

Method & Evidence

AimWhat are the historical precedents for economic transitions following major collapses, and how can these inform future sustainable urban development in the context of climate change and new economic drivers?
MethodHistorical analysis and scenario planning
ProcedureThe paper examines past economic collapses and the subsequent waves of innovation, linking them to changes in energy, infrastructure, transport, and urban form. It then projects these patterns onto current trends, particularly those driven by the Paris Agreement and SDGs, to forecast potential urban transformations.

The COVID-19 pandemic has highlighted the potential for significant economic transitions, mirroring historical precedents where collapses have spurred waves of innovation. This research suggests that future economic development will be strongly influenced by sustainability agendas, such as the Paris Agreement and SDGs, leading to urban transformations characterized by 'global localism,' distributed infrastructure, and reduced car dependence. Designers can leverage these insights to integrate sustainable technologies and foster resilient urban environments.
